5f568053 | 42 | EDK_3926: Compatible: jlin16\r |
43 | \r | |
44 | Class_BuildTool:\r | |
45 | 1) Added support of Capsule generation from FDF file.\r | |
46 | \r | |
47 | Code Change :\r | |
48 | 1)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/build.exe\r | |
49 | 2)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/GenFds.exe\r | |
50 | \r | |
51 | Possible Impacts:\r | |
52 | 1) To generate capsule, insert [Capsule] section after [FV] sections and specifying\r | |
53 | what FV will be put into capsule, For example:\r | |
54 | [Capsule.Fob]\r | |
55 | CAPSULE_GUID = 3B6686BD-0D76-4030-B70E-B5519E2FC5A0\r | |
56 | CAPSULE_FLAG = PersistAcrossReset\r | |
57 | FV = BiosUpdate\r | |
58 | \r | |

679efe0a | 60 | EDK_3911: Compatible: jlin16\r |
61 | \r | |
62 | Class_BuildTool:\r | |
63 | 1) Added support of Apriori file generation from FDF file.\r | |
64 | 2) Added support of INF that describes binary files to put binary into FV.\r | |
65 | 3) Fixed single FV/FD generation error when specifying -i/-r option in GenFds.\r | |
66 | \r | |
67 | \r | |
68 | Code Change :\r | |
69 | 1)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/build.exe\r | |
70 | 2)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/GenFds.exe\r | |
71 | \r | |
72 | Possible Impacts:\r | |
73 | 1) To generate Apriori file in FV, insert APRIORI statement just before the INF or\r | |
74 | FILE statement list of the FV, For example:\r | |
75 | APRIORI PEI {\r | |
76 | INF MdeModulePkg/Universal/PCD/Pei/Pcd.inf\r | |
77 | FILE PEIM = B7A5041A-78BA-49e3-B73B-54C757811FB6 {\r | |
78 | SECTION PE32 = MyBinPkg\bin\ia32\PeimAfterPcd.efi\r | |
79 | }\r | |
80 | INF IntelFrameworkModulePkg/Universal/StatusCode/Pei/PeiStatusCode.inf\r | |
81 | }\r | |
82 | 2) To add binary file described by INF file into FV, only insert the INF statement\r | |
83 | into the INF statements list of that FV, like this:\r | |
84 | \r | |
85 | INF RuleOverride=Test MdeModulePkg/Logo/Logo.inf\r | |
86 | \r | |
87 | Specifying how to process the binary file by defining corresponding Rule like this:\r | |
88 | [Rule.Common.Base.Test]\r | |
89 | FILE FREEFORM = $(NAMED_GUID) {\r | |
90 | COMPRESS PI_STD {\r | |
91 | GUIDED {\r | |
92 | RAW BIN |.bmp \r | |
93 | }\r | |
94 | }\r | |
95 | }\r | |

156 | EDK_3789: Non-Compatible: lgao4\r | |
157 | \r | |
158 | Class_BuildTool: support new Rules format and PCD format defined in FDF file\r | |
159 | \r | |
160 | Code Change :\r | |
161 | 1)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/build.exe\r | |
162 | 2) BaseTools/Bin/Win32/GenFds.exe\r | |
163 | \r | |
164 | Possible Impacts:\r | |
8fb31ab7 LG |
165 | 1) All platform's FDF file, if any, must be changed to new format.\r |
166 | a) PCD format is changed from old PcdName to new PcdTokenSpaceGuid.PcdName, for example PcdWinNtFdBaseAddress in old FDF file will be replaced by gEfiNt32PkgTokenSpaceGuid.PcdWinNtFdBaseAddres.\r | |
167 | b) Rule format adds binary file type and file postfix name support, and doesn't require the full file path. For example:\r | |
168 | Old Peim Rule:\r | |
169 | [Rule.Common.PEIM]\r | |
170 | FILE PEIM = $(NAMED_GUID) {\r | |
171 | PEI_DEPEX Optional $(INF_OUTPUT)/$(MODULE_NAME).Depex\r | |
172 | PE32 $(INF_OUTPUT)/$(MODULE_NAME).efi\r | |
173 | UI Optional $(MODULE_NAME)\r | |
174 | VERSION Optional BUILD_NUM=$(BUILD_NUMBER) $(INF_VERSION)\r | |
175 | }\r | |
176 | New Peim Rule:\r | |
177 | [Rule.Common.PEIM]\r | |
178 | FILE PEIM = $(NAMED_GUID) {\r | |
179 | PEI_DEPEX PEI_DEPEX Optional |.Depex\r | |
180 | PE32 PE32 |.efi\r | |
181 | UI STRING="$(MODULE_NAME)" Optional \r | |
182 | VERSION STRING="$(INF_VERSION)" Optional BUILD_NUM=$(BUILD_NUMBER) \r | |
183 | }\r | |
